The Chris Byars Octet: Lucky Strikes Again

Read "Lucky Strikes Again" reviewed by Greg Simmons


If a theorem states: “three harmonizing saxophones create compelling, rich, sonic textures," then the proof is the Chris Byars Octet's homage to saxophonist Lucky Thompson, Lucky Strikes Again. Lucky Thompson (1924-2005) is primarily remembered as a bebop saxophonist, but he was also a fine and underrated composer, leading small and mid-sized bands. Byars has ...
